在阿里云上安装 CentOS 8.2 的教程通常指的是通过阿里云控制台创建一台基于 CentOS 8.2 镜像的云服务器(ECS)。由于 CentOS 8 已于 2021 年底停止维护,官方不再提供更新支持,因此建议使用替代系统如 CentOS Stream 8、AlmaLinux 8 或 Rocky Linux 8。不过如果你仍需要 CentOS 8.2,可以按照以下步骤操作。
✅ 一、准备工作
-
注册阿里云账号
- 访问 阿里云官网
- 注册并完成实名认证。
-
登录阿里云控制台
- 登录后进入 ECS 控制台
✅ 二、创建 ECS 实例(选择 CentOS 8.2)
步骤 1:创建实例
- 在 ECS 控制台点击 “创建实例”。
- 选择 “按量付费” 或 “包年包月”(新手建议按量,灵活)。
步骤 2:选择地域和可用区
- 选择离你用户最近的地域(如华北3 – 张家口、华东1 – 杭州等)。
步骤 3:选择实例规格
- 推荐入门配置:
ecs.c6.large(2核4G)或ecs.t6-c1m2.large(突发性能实例,更便宜)。
步骤 4:镜像选择(关键步骤)
- 点击 “公共镜像” 标签。
- 在操作系统中选择 “CentOS”。
- 查看是否有 CentOS 8.2 64位 的选项。
⚠️ 注意:阿里云可能已下架 CentOS 8.2 的官方镜像(因 EOL),若没有,可尝试:
- 使用 CentOS 8 阿里云定制版(如果有)
- 或选择 CentOS 8.4 / 8.5(更接近且仍可用)
- 或改用 AlmaLinux 8 或 Rocky Linux 8(推荐替代)
如果必须使用 CentOS 8.2,可以考虑上传自定义镜像(见后文)。
步骤 5:存储配置
- 系统盘:默认 40GB 高效云盘 或 SSD(推荐 SSD)。
- 数据盘(可选):按需添加。
步骤 6:网络配置
- 专有网络 VPC:默认即可。
- 安全组:选择已有或新建,确保开放所需端口(如 SSH 22、HTTP 80、HTTPS 443)。
步骤 7:设置登录凭证
- 推荐使用 SSH 密钥对(更安全)
- 创建密钥对并下载私钥(
.pem文件)
- 创建密钥对并下载私钥(
- 或设置密码(不推荐明文密码)
步骤 8:确认并创建
- 勾选服务协议,点击 “创建实例”
✅ 三、连接到 CentOS 8.2 服务器
方法 1:使用 SSH 连接(Linux/Mac)
ssh -i /path/to/your-key.pem root@<公网IP>
首次连接可能会提示信任主机,输入 yes。
方法 2:Windows 用户使用 PuTTY 或 Xshell
- 将
.pem转为.ppk(使用 PuTTYgen) - 配置连接:IP + 端口 22 + 用户名
root
✅ 四、初始化配置(可选)
# 更新系统(但注意 CentOS 8 已 EOL,yum 可能失败)
dnf clean all
dnf makecache
# 若提示无法连接 mirror.centos.org,说明源已失效
# 可切换为阿里云镜像源(临时方案)
替换为阿里云镜像源(修复 yum 失效问题)
cd /etc/yum.repos.d
sed -i 's/mirrorlist/#mirrorlist/g' /etc/yum.repos.d/CentOS-*
sed -i 's|#baseurl=http://mirror.centos.org|baseurl=http://vault.aliyuncs.com|g' /etc/yum.repos.d/CentOS-*
# 或手动替换为 vault 源
💡 提示:CentOS 8 官方源已归档至
vault.centos.org,国内访问慢,建议尽快迁移到 CentOS Stream 或其他替代系统。
✅ 五、(可选)自定义镜像导入 CentOS 8.2
如果你必须使用特定版本的 CentOS 8.2,可自行制作镜像并上传:
- 下载 CentOS 8.2 ISO 镜像(archive.kernel.org/centos/8.2.2004/)
- 使用 VirtualBox / VMware 创建虚拟机并安装
- 按照阿里云要求打包成 qcow2 镜像
- 上传至 OSS,再导入为自定义镜像
- 使用该镜像创建 ECS 实例
参考文档:
- 阿里云导入自定义镜像
✅ 六、强烈建议:使用替代系统
由于 CentOS 8 已停止维护,生产环境不推荐使用。建议选择:
| 替代系统 | 特点 |
|---|---|
| CentOS Stream 8 | Red Hat 官方支持,持续更新 |
| AlmaLinux 8 | 与 RHEL 二进制兼容,免费 |
| Rocky Linux 8 | 由原 CentOS 创始人开发,稳定 |
在阿里云镜像市场搜索这些系统,体验更好且长期支持。
✅ 总结
| 步骤 | 内容 |
|---|---|
| 1 | 登录阿里云 ECS 控制台 |
| 2 | 创建实例,选择 CentOS 8.x 镜像(若有) |
| 3 | 配置实例规格、网络、安全组 |
| 4 | 设置 SSH 密钥登录 |
| 5 | 连接服务器,更换镜像源(必要时) |
| 6 | 考虑迁移到 CentOS Stream 或 AlmaLinux |
如需我提供 AlmaLinux 8 或 CentOS Stream 8 的安装教程,也可以继续提问!
是否需要一键部署脚本或 LNMP 环境配置?欢迎继续交流!
云计算HECS